Medieval ship discovered off Copenhagen may be the world's largest cog - Medievalists.net

A 15th-century cog named Svælget 2, approximately 28m long with ~300-ton capacity, is the largest known, revealing rare medieval ship construction details.

Famed polar exploration ship Endurance not as strong as legend held, researcher says

What if one of the most famous and formidable Antarctic exploration vessels in history, whose crew's story of shipwreck and survival has been told for more than a century, wasn't as strong as legend had it? A new research paper about the vessel Endurance casts doubt on some common beliefs about explorer Ernest Shackleton's ship, particularly that it was one of the most well-built ships of its era and that it went down due to the loss of its rudder after becoming trapped in sea ice in 1915.
